Detached | 2-Storey | 31-50 Years Old
4 Bed | 4 bath
222 2ND Ave, Hanover
Hanover | 222 2nd Ave, Hanover Ontario
35 Detached homes | 10 Semi detached | 2 Townhomes | Average house price is $664,906 | Lowest price is $199,900